Raw dataset of the impact of social media usage on the academic performance of university students in Bangladesh, with a particular focus on the mediating role of mental health

Description

Data on the juncture of social media use, academic performance, and mental health among university students in developing countries like Bangladesh remains scarce. This dataset provides detailed information on social media usage patterns, academic outcomes, and levels of anxiety, depression, and loneliness among university students. We believe this data can support researchers and policymakers in understanding the complex relationship between digital behavior and mental well-being, enabling the design of targeted interventions to promote healthier academic and psychological outcomes for students.
